AKRON, Ohio - It will truly feel like spring on Thursday - if not summer. Akronites can expect a warm-up to the upper 70s, with mostly sunny skies amplifying the highly anticipated heat.
Morning lows will dip to the mid to upper 50s. Winds will be a bit breezy, but with temperatures so warm there won't be much of a wind chill.
In the late afternoon Akron will reach the high of 77 degrees, before settling in the low 70s to mid 60s the rest of the evening. Again, winds will speed up but there shouldn't be a noticeable chill.
High pressure will keep the skies mostly sunny, and rain chances at bay. However, Friday will be the last hot day with sun before widespread thunderstorms move in this weekend.
